Classical and Flamenco guitar virtuoso Adam Del Monte stopped by the Guitar Salon International showroom and recorded a lesson on flamenco tremolo for us. Here he's playing a 2006 Conde Hermnanos 'Esteso' (tinyurl.com/ch2eeot ).

Dayvid, Just kill time with lots of practice employing the advice given in the video - Del Monte achieved a very complete technique by lots of hard work over several years. I wish he had stressed the importance of rhythmic regularity in tremolo achieved by counting, e.g the standard pami played with a even count of 1-2-3-4 - avoiding the common fault of quasi-triplet rhythm by a-m-i following a too-long gap after the thumb pluck - (flamenco version played to regular count of 1-2-3-4-5),
